Major irregularities in election campaign's financing; Moldovan Central Electoral Commission sends files to Anti-Corruption Prosecutor's Office

The Central Electoral Commission (CEC) today approved reports on the comprehensive control of financing of four political parties and the electoral campaign of independent candidate Victoria Furtuna, for the period of July 1 - October 31, 2024.

According to the CEC, following verifications, the REVIVAL Party was ordered to transfer 79,128.79 lei to the state budget, a sum derived from donations made by individuals, collected in violation of the law. The party must inform the Commission of the actions taken by August 19, 2025.

The institution also notified the Anti-Corruption Prosecutor's Office (PA) regarding political, social and cultural events organized by the REVIVAL Party, the CHANCE Party, the VICTORY Party, and the Force for Alternative and Salvation of Moldova without supporting documents, estimated at 2.91 million lei — an amount classified as "particularly large proportions."

CEC specifies that the Justice Ministry will also be informed to apply the measures provided by the law.

At the same time, Victoria Furtuna, as a successor of the independent candidate in the presidential elections, was ordered to contribute 229,636 lei to the budget, an amount not indicated in the financial report of the campaign.
